Welcome to Badsworth Parish Council

Badsworth is a lovely village situated in West Yorkshire and is approximately 10 miles South East of Wakefield and 10 miles North West of Doncaster. It has a population of approximately 600 people and is mainly a residential community centred round the Grade 1 Listed St Mary’s Parish Church and Badsworth Church of England Junior and Infant school.

Badsworth, in common with a lot of villages, has existed since before 1086 and is listed in the Doomsday Book as Badesuurde.
